site stats

Embedded 5 steps software architecture

WebOct 13, 2012 · Embedded Software Abstraction Design methodology used to hide hardware architecture details from the application software domain by the isolation and … WebJan 26, 2024 · An embedded systems engineer might also use these four steps to effectively develop or improve an embedded system: Define the goal of the embedded system. This includes researching the needs of a system in a certain industry and communicating with company executives to understand the technology the company …

Software and Hardware Architecture for Autonomous Robots …

WebJun 9, 2024 · 1. Analysis 2. Design 3. Implementation If we will go a little bit deeper to the development steps it includes these 7 steps : … Web3 Software Architectures for Embedded Control Systems Software architecture, according to ANSI/IEEE Standard 1471-2000, is defined as the “fundamental organi-zation of a system, embodied in its components, their relationships to each other and the environment, and the principles governing its design and evolution.” Embedded … thothmes https://redroomunderground.com

5 Essential Steps of Embedded Firmware Development

WebDec 2, 2024 · A software architecture must adhere to SOLID principle to avoid any architectural or developmental failure. S.O.L.I.D PRINCIPLE Single Responsibility – … WebNov 19, 2024 · This article closes out the series by examining the last step; Simulate, iterate, and scale. The last several articles have explored the five steps to designing an … WebNov 4, 2024 · 5 Essential Steps of Embedded Firmware Development It is preferable to proceed in steps for individuals unfamiliar with Embedded Firmware Development’s overall operation. You get a segmented … thoth monkey

Embedded Software Organization: Architecture and Design

Category:How to Become a Software Architect? - GeeksforGeeks

Tags:Embedded 5 steps software architecture

Embedded 5 steps software architecture

Software Architectures and Embedded Systems

WebMar 25, 2024 · Software architecture design helps to connect the technical and operational aspects by defining and structuring a solution. The architecture and designing part can be broken down into two pieces. Software Architecture –. Architecture defines the blueprints of a system. It serves as a communication and coordination mechanism for the elements.

Embedded 5 steps software architecture

Did you know?

WebOct 13, 2012 · Embedded Software Abstraction Design methodology used to hide hardware architecture details from the application software domain by the isolation and encapsulation of relevant parameters that describe the behavior of an specific hardware entity, in order to facilitate software component reusability and portability Software … WebMar 25, 2024 · Embedded System is a combination of computer software and hardware which is either fixed in capability or programmable. An embedded system can be either an independent system, or it can be a …

WebSep 17, 2024 · You need to have a deep understanding of Design Patterns & Architecture, Fundamentals of Data Modeling, Unified Modeling Language (UML), and other related concepts to start your career as a … WebOct 6, 2024 · 5 Software Architecture Killers October 6, 2024 The chip shortage has forced many embedded systems companies to rethink their software architecture. Many embedded systems have tightly coupled …

WebDec 13, 2024 · 1. Standalone embedded systems. Operating within a larger system is a key characteristic of embedded systems, but the standalone variety can function … WebJul 9, 2024 · A software architecture will identify the major components in the system, their inputs, outputs and how they interact with each other. This activity can help a developer understand how the software can be organized and allows them to think through scalability and reuse issues.

WebFeb 14, 2024 · Hardware and embedded firmware (including the operating system) will depend on key nonvehicle functional requirements instead of being allocated part of a vehicle functional domain. To allow for …

Many embedded software teams look at their software architecture as a single cohesive architecture that includes both the application code and the hardware interactions. Viewing architecture this way is not surprising because embedded software engineers often look at their system from the hardware … See more First, they are not very portable. For example, what happens if a microcontroller suddenly becomes unavailable? (Chip … See more Separating the software architecture into hardware-dependent and independent architectures solves all the problems with a tightly coupled … See more undercover photo albumsWebMar 29, 2024 · Step 5. Design of Software Development Product User research and information architecture Wireframes and mockups UI/UX design Usability testing Step 6. Development Process Project artifacts Project meetings Step 7. Testing What do we test at Relevant? Manual tests vs. automated tests Test-driven development (TDD) Step 8. undercover padded protective shortsWebMay 31, 2024 · Software architecture diagramming and patterns. May 31, 2024 - 20 min read. Crystal Song. A software’s architecture is the foundation for any successful … thoth mid buildWebThe baseline in selecting the architecture is that it should realize all which typically consists of the list of modules, brief functionality of each module, their interface relationships, dependencies, database tables, architecture diagrams, technology details etc. The integration testing design is carried out in the particular phase. [3] thoth minor arcanaWebOct 9, 2024 · The architecture of high-end BMSes has the same principle, but it is multilevel. Complex BMSes may have extra power supplies, sensors, contactors, fans, and other units. The multilevel BMS developed by our engineering team includes: An energy management system (EMS) A sensing subsystem A protection subsystem A security … undercover planned parenthood videoWebIn this article, I’ve distilled the five architectures into a quick reference of the strengths and weaknesses, as well as optimal use cases. Remember that you can use multiple patterns in a single system to optimize each section … undercover prodigy twitterWebOct 1, 2012 · In this paper, we propose the software and hardware architecture for specifically Autonomous Robots using distributed embedded system. These concepts have implemented in developing a prototype ... undercover photography